据 9to5 Mac 报道,苹果发布了 iOS 15.4 Beta 1 预览版,面向开发者和公共测试用户推出。

这次更新,带有多种新功能,暗示了 Safari 浏览器将出现一些受欢迎的变化。

更具体地说,苹果最终致力于为 iOS 上的 Web 应用启用推送通知,以及支持 AR / VR 头显的 WebXR API。

正如开发者 Maximiliano Firtman 所指出的,iOS 15.4 测试版引入了可供网站和 Web 应用使用的新功能。

其中之一是支持通用的自定义图标,所以开发者不再需要添加特定的代码来为 iOS 设备提供 Web 应用的图标。

“四年来,我们在 iOS 上的 Safari 支持 Web App Manifest,但图标声明总是被忽视(苹果或 WebKit 从未记录过这种缺乏支持的情况)。

这导致许多在 iOS 上安装的渐进式网络应用程序(PWA)没有一个合适的图标;

因为你还需要在 HTML 中添加带有 rel=apple-touch-icon 的 ,而不是每个 PWA 开发者都在这样做。”

然而,最值得注意还没有到来的变化--那就是 Web 应用的推送通知。

虽然 macOS 上的 Safari 允许网站在网页处于后台时(或在某些情况下甚至在应用关闭时)向用户提供提醒,但苹果从未在 iOS 上启用同样的功能。

关键词: 苹果 iOS5 4